Fe-H_2O_2-次甲基绿催化分光光度法测定痕量铁(Ⅲ) 被引量:17

Catalytic Spectrophotometric Determination of Trace Iron (Ⅲ)

摘要 在HCI介质中,Fe(Ⅲ)强烈地催化过氧化氢氧化次甲基绿的反应,据此建立了催化分光光度法测定痕量Fe(Ⅲ)的新方法。本方法的检出限为0.005ug/25mL,测定范围为0~0.25μg/mL,并用本法对人发、饮用水、环境标准样品进行了分析。 A catalytic spectrophotometric method for the determination of trace Fe(Ⅲ) based on the oxidzation of methylene green with H_2O_2 by means of Fe(Ⅲ) as catalyst has been investigated. The detection limit is 0.005μg/25mL and the linear response is in the range of 0 to 0.25μg/25mL. The effect of foreign ions has been studied and the method shows good selectivity. The proposed method has been applied to analyse biological and water samples with satisfactory results.
